The market here reflects Georgia's broader trend toward rural revival, with Thomson serving as the county seat and primary commercial hub while smaller communities like Dearing and White Plains offer distinct residential character. What sets McDuffie County apart is its proximity to Augusta's metropolitan influence while maintaining authentically rural pricing and lifestyle advantages.
Thomson dominates the county's real estate activity, anchoring transactions with its historic downtown district and established neighborhoods that blend antebellum charm with modern conveniences. The city's position along major transportation corridors has attracted both residential buyers seeking small-town living and commercial investors recognizing untapped potential in this strategically located market.
Beyond Thomson, communities like Dearing capitalize on their pastoral settings and proximity to Clarks Hill Lake, creating niche markets for recreational properties and retirement homes. The county's geographic diversity—from rolling farmland to lakefront parcels—means agents here often specialize across multiple property types, making their expertise particularly valuable for businesses serving diverse client needs.
McDuffie County's real estate patterns defy simple categorization, with agricultural land conversions, lake property developments, and suburban-style subdivisions all competing for buyer attention simultaneously. This complexity requires agents to navigate everything from historic preservation considerations in Thomson's downtown to environmental regulations affecting lakefront construction projects.
The market's seasonal fluctuations tied to lake recreation, combined with steady year-round demand from Augusta commuters, creates interesting pricing dynamics that reward agents with deep local knowledge. Properties here often sit longer than metro markets but command surprising premiums when they align with buyer preferences for space, privacy, and authentic Georgia character.
